Structured support from intake through review.

Services are scoped to the matter, the available authority, the evidence, and the professional roles involved. Deliverables are organized for lawful investigator use and attorney review.

01

Case organization

Master chronologies, allegation maps, issue lists, document indexes, deadline tracking, and next-action plans.

02

Evidence control

Evidence ledgers, source verification, reliability classifications, chain-of-custody fields, and missing-evidence identification.

03

Investigation support

Lawful investigation plans, witness lists, interview preparation, records tracking, field documentation, and unresolved-question analysis.

04

Legal-support operations

Attorney briefing materials, hearing preparation, exhibit organization, subpoena and records-request lists, and draft support documents.

05

Records analysis

Comparison of reports, orders, communications, service plans, testing records, and other source materials for contradictions and gaps.

06

Workflow design

Private case-management, parent-update, deadline, evidence, and review workflows designed for controlled professional use.
